为什么G-Helper比Armoury Crate更适合你的华硕笔记本?5个隐藏优势详解
【免费下载链接】g-helperLightweight, open-source control tool for ASUS laptops and ROG Ally. Manage performance modes, fans, GPU, battery, and RGB lighting across Zephyrus, Flow, TUF, Strix, Scar, and other models.项目地址: https://gitcode.com/GitHub_Trending/gh/g-helper
当你购买了一台ROG幻系列、天选系列或枪神魔霸系列笔记本时,你可能不知道,预装的Armoury Crate软件正在悄悄占用你的系统资源。G-Helper作为一款轻量级开源控制工具,不仅功能全面,还能将系统资源消耗降至最低,为你的华硕笔记本提供纯净高效的硬件管理体验。
G-Helper浅色主题界面展示性能模式切换和风扇曲线调节功能
🔧 当你的笔记本需要"瘦身"时
你是否遇到过这样的场景:系统运行缓慢,打开任务管理器发现Armoury Crate占用了数百MB内存?或者风扇疯狂旋转,但CPU使用率并不高?这正是G-Helper要解决的核心问题。
技术原理简析:G-Helper不安装任何系统服务,仅通过Asus System Control Interface驱动与BIOS通信,这使其内存占用比Armoury Crate减少约70-80%。它就像一个高效的"遥控器",直接调用华硕预设的硬件控制接口。
性能对比表格
| 对比维度 | Armoury Crate | G-Helper | 优势 |
|---|---|---|---|
| 内存占用 | 200-300 MB | 20-50 MB | ⚡️ 减少70-80% |
| 启动时间 | 3-5秒 | <1秒 | ⚡️ 快3-5倍 |
| 系统服务 | 多个后台进程 | 零安装 | 🚀 更纯净 |
| 更新频率 | 厂商推送 | 社区驱动 | 🔄 更及时 |
| 自定义程度 | 有限 | 完全开放 | 🎛️ 更高自由度 |
🎮 三种性能模式的实际应用场景
静音模式:深夜工作的最佳伴侣
当你在图书馆或深夜工作时,风扇噪音会成为最大干扰。G-Helper的静音模式将风扇转速降至最低,同时配合BIOS预设的"Best power efficiency"电源模式,实现真正的安静运行。
技术实现:通过app/HardwareControl.cs中的风扇控制逻辑,G-Helper调用华硕WMI接口调整风扇曲线,确保在低噪音下维持系统稳定。
平衡模式:日常使用的智能选择
这是大多数用户日常使用的模式,在性能和噪音之间取得完美平衡。G-Helper会自动根据电源状态调整配置:
- 电池模式:启用节能配置,延长续航
- 电源模式:恢复高性能状态,确保流畅体验
增强模式:游戏与专业应用的释放
启动游戏或进行视频渲染时,G-Helper可以自动切换到增强模式和独显直连。与传统显卡切换不同,它实现了真正的"无缝切换",无需重启系统或关闭应用程序。
G-Helper深色主题界面展示功率限制和风扇曲线调节功能
🔋 电池健康保护的隐藏技巧
充电上限设置的科学依据
G-Helper允许设置60%/80%/100%充电上限,这基于锂电池的化学特性:
- 60%上限:长期插电使用,最大化电池寿命
- 80%上限:兼顾续航与寿命的最佳平衡点
- 100%上限:需要最大续航时的临时选择
常见误区:很多人认为"充满电对电池最好",实际上锂电池在100%电量下承受的化学应力最大,长期保持满电会加速老化。
自动化场景适配
软件能够根据电源状态自动调整多项设置:
- 性能模式记忆:记住每个电源状态下的偏好设置
- 显卡自动切换:电池模式下禁用独显,插电时启用
- 屏幕刷新率智能调节:电池时60Hz,插电时最高刷新率
- 键盘背光超时管理:电池模式下自动关闭背光
🖥️ 显卡管理的技术突破
四种GPU模式详解
| 模式 | 技术原理 | 适用场景 |
|---|---|---|
| Eco模式 | 仅启用集成GPU,独立GPU完全关闭 | 移动办公、长续航需求 |
| Standard模式 | iGPU和dGPU同时启用,iGPU驱动内置显示 | 日常使用、轻度游戏 |
| Ultimate模式 | dGPU直接驱动内置显示(2022+型号支持) | 专业应用、高性能游戏 |
| Optimized模式 | 电池时Eco,插电时Standard自动切换 | 智能平衡性能与续航 |
无缝切换的秘密:G-Helper通过app/Gpu/目录下的GPU控制模块,直接与NVIDIA和AMD驱动通信,实现硬件级别的模式切换,无需重启系统。
🎛️ 风扇曲线的艺术与科学
G-Helper提供了8组温度与风扇速度的百分比数值,让你可以创建专属的散热方案。但如何设置才是最优的?
风扇曲线设置建议
# 静音型曲线(适合办公) 温度点: [40, 50, 60, 65, 70, 75, 80, 85] 风扇速度: [0, 20, 40, 50, 60, 70, 80, 90] # 平衡型曲线(适合游戏) 温度点: [40, 50, 60, 65, 70, 75, 80, 85] 风扇速度: [30, 40, 50, 60, 70, 80, 90, 100] # 性能型曲线(适合渲染) 温度点: [40, 50, 55, 60, 65, 70, 75, 80] 风扇速度: [40, 60, 70, 80, 90, 95, 100, 100]技术细节:风扇控制逻辑位于app/Fan/FanSensorControl.cs,通过读取温度传感器数据并应用曲线算法,实时调整风扇转速。
🖱️ 外设支持的全面覆盖
从ROG Chakram X到TUF Gaming M5,G-Helper几乎支持所有主流华硕外设。app/Peripherals/目录包含了完整的鼠标模型定义,确保每个设备都能获得最佳配置。
鼠标配置文件示例
// app/Peripherals/Mouse/Models/ChakramX.cs public class ChakramX : AsusMouse { public ChakramX() : base(0x0B05, 0x1A6B) { // 设备特定配置 DPIStages = new int[] { 400, 800, 1600, 3200 }; ButtonCount = 12; HasRGB = true; } }🔌 安装与配置的最佳实践
快速开始指南
下载最新版本:从项目仓库获取最新发布包
git clone https://gitcode.com/GitHub_Trending/gh/g-helper解压到指定目录:避免使用临时文件夹,建议放在
C:\Program Files\GHelper\或用户目录运行GHelper.exe:首次运行会自动检测硬件配置
配置自动化规则:在设置中启用"Auto Apply"和"Optimized GPU"选项
系统要求检查
- ✅ Microsoft .NET 7运行环境
- ✅ 华硕系统控制接口驱动
- ✅ 管理员权限(首次运行)
🚀 高级使用技巧
自定义电源计划集成
通过在配置文件中添加自定义电源设置的GUID,你可以为每个性能模式创建专属的电源管理方案:
<!-- 自定义电源计划示例 --> <PowerPlan> <SilentMode>a1841308-3541-4fab-bc81-f71556f20b4a</SilentMode> <BalancedMode>381b4222-f694-41f0-9685-ff5bb260df2e</BalancedMode> <TurboMode>8c5e7fda-e8bf-4a96-9a85-a6e23a8c635c</TurboMode> </PowerPlan>热键行为定制
G-Helper支持运行任意应用程序或模拟Windows按键,满足个性化需求:
| 快捷键 | 默认行为 | 自定义建议 |
|---|---|---|
Ctrl + Shift + F12 | 打开G-Helper窗口 | 保持不变 |
Ctrl + M1/M2 | 屏幕亮度调节 | 可改为音量控制 |
Fn + C | Fn-Lock切换 | 可绑定特定应用 |
⚠️ 常见问题与解决方案
Q: G-Helper会影响保修吗?
A: 不会。G-Helper仅使用华硕官方提供的硬件接口,不修改BIOS或固件,完全在操作系统层面工作。
Q: 可以同时使用Armoury Crate和G-Helper吗?
A: 不建议。两者可能产生冲突,建议完全卸载Armoury Crate后再使用G-Helper。
Q: 如何恢复默认设置?
A: 在"Fans + Power"界面点击"Factory Defaults"按钮,或删除%APPDATA%\GHelper\目录下的配置文件。
Q: 支持哪些华硕笔记本型号?
A: 支持ROG Zephyrus G14/G15/G16、Flow X13/X16/Z13、TUF系列、Strix系列、Scar系列、ProArt、Vivobook、Zenbook等主流型号。
G-Helper与HWInfo传感器工具叠加展示硬件监控数据
🛠️ 开发者视角:G-Helper的技术架构
核心模块设计
G-Helper采用模块化设计,主要功能分布在以下目录:
app/ ├── Mode/ # 性能模式控制 ├── Gpu/ # GPU模式管理 ├── Fan/ # 风扇曲线控制 ├── Battery/ # 电池健康管理 ├── Peripherals/ # 外设支持 └── USB/ # 硬件通信接口开源贡献指南
如果你对G-Helper的开发感兴趣,可以从以下方面入手:
- 设备支持:在
app/Peripherals/Mouse/Models/中添加新设备定义 - 功能扩展:参考
app/HardwareControl.cs实现新的硬件控制逻辑 - 本地化:帮助翻译
app/Properties/Strings.*.resx文件
📈 未来发展方向
G-Helper的开发团队持续关注用户反馈,未来计划包括:
- 更多外设设备的原生支持
- 云端配置同步功能
- 移动端远程控制应用
- 更精细的功耗监控与分析
通过深度优化和持续改进,G-Helper已经成为华硕设备用户不可或缺的工具。它不仅提供了强大的硬件控制能力,更带来了前所未有的使用便利和系统纯净度。无论你是追求极致性能的游戏玩家,还是需要长续航的移动办公用户,G-Helper都能为你提供最佳的硬件管理体验。
提示:定期检查官方文档获取最新功能和更新信息,社区讨论和问题反馈可以在项目仓库中找到解决方案。
【免费下载链接】g-helperLightweight, open-source control tool for ASUS laptops and ROG Ally. Manage performance modes, fans, GPU, battery, and RGB lighting across Zephyrus, Flow, TUF, Strix, Scar, and other models.项目地址: https://gitcode.com/GitHub_Trending/gh/g-helper
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考